img {
	-ms-interpolation-mode: bicubic;
	border: 0;
	margin: 0;
	padding: 0;
	vertical-align: bottom;
}

#maincolumn img {
	max-width: 542px;
}


#wrapper.fullwidth #maincolumn.fullwidth img {
	max-width: 968px;
}

#sidebar_right img {
	max-width: 220px;
}

#sidebar_left img {
	max-width: 224px;
}

#footer1 img.footerlogoimg {
	max-width: 110px;
}


#wrapper img {
	height: auto !important;
	max-width: 100% !important;
	width: auto !important;
}
